The tour I had at Juniper Village at Lebanon was fine. The apartment was very nice and very spacious. They could do everything I really wanted. It was just kind of far away from everything in the sense of going to stores or the distance. The lady said they were only about ten minutes or so away from those, but I didn't get to really go through and see how far it was away. I know it was. From where I'm living in Akron to there, it probably took me about a half an hour to get there. I didn't think it was going to be that far, but it actually was. If I was talking in common terms, it seemed like it was extremely back in the woods. In general though it's very nice. It seemed like it could meet all my needs. I have a puppy, and they said I'd be able to have her there, and that was great. The price seemed very fair and reasonable. It's going to be caring for all of my bills. The electricity and everything would be paid for, which was nice. So in general, I still like it. I was thinking of that being the place, because even though it was a little distant, it seemed like an adequate place for me at that point because I didn't want to go too far away from the Akron area. I had friends there that I liked to be able to see. I didn't want to travel into York or anywhere too far. If I need a bus for transportation, they offer it. It's a little extra money, but it is fine. The food was extra. The other facility I went to had a better menu and you could order a lot more food, whereas Juniper Village at Lebanon really didn't have it as much, because they said most of the people there actually don't come and eat. Most of them eat in their own places. It's only once in a while that they might come up and have something to eat there. They give you a washer and dryer right in the apartment. The lady said that if I needed anything changed, like a bulb or something, I would have to pay for that, but in general, if there was a problem with the stove or the refrigerator, that's their responsibility, and the heating and anything that's included in it. Now, if I wanted something put up, like a picture or hooks and things in the closet, she says that was extra for their maintenance. When it snows, they will clean your car off and move it and put it back in its place, and that's not extra or anything. They take care of the grounds. If we want to plant any plant, we can. They have no problem with that. The trash can is kept on the bottom ground. As long as you put your trash in the trash can, they take it and put it out back. They empty it. The lady was very pleasant and wanted to help in every way possible, and was very compassionate. The facility looks very well-kept.

About Juniper Village at Lebanon in Lebanon, Pennsylvania
Juniper Village at Lebanon provides residents with a great lifestyle for senior living! At Juniper Village we believe that healthy aging requires maintaining and promoting an active body, an engaged mind, and a fulfilled spirit. Whether you enjoy peaceful solitary activities or lively social events, there are always plenty of options at Juniper Village at Lebanon. Enjoy our open lounges with inviting stone fireplaces in the cooler months or our shady walkways and gardens to beat the summer heat. You can also stop by our resident technology library or participate in an exercise or advanced learning class in our town hall. Savor your meals in our stunning dining room with vaulted ceiling and enormous windows that allow sunlight to pour in.
Juniper Village at Lebanon is a three building campus conveniently located in South Lebanon Township, just east of the city of Lebanon. Our personal care community features 81 private and semi-private rooms, each with private bath, kitchenettes, and individually controlled heating and cooling. Our independent senior living community is located right next door and features 40 large, bright one and two bedroom apartments. We have apartments located both on the ground floor and on the second floor, for those who still want the exercise of stairs! Unlike many other independent living communities in the area, there is no upfront buy-in for our apartments. We offer a simple lease agreement with the comfort of knowing that if you need it, our personal care community is just a few steps away.
